Alonso expects more competitive McLaren in Austria
Fernando Alonso feels McLaren-Honda can expect a more competitive race weekend in the Austrian Grand Prix than the team managed in Azerbaijan as it looks to kick-off the European mid-season with a return to the points. The Spaniard, along with team-mate Jenson Button, failed to make it into the top ten in Baku, Alonso retiring with technical problems in the closing stages of the race.
